Output 59b101ac3393159584f49e295ceea6c5431c0a40c09172cccfb73fbf182d974f:60

value
6300000
script pubkey
OP_0 OP_PUSHBYTES_20 c36e70c2a50004e15e5766d276e3f5d3a3c6f38a
address
bc1qcdh8ps49qqzwzhjhvmf8dcl46w3uduu27f3hem
transaction
59b101ac3393159584f49e295ceea6c5431c0a40c09172cccfb73fbf182d974f
spent
true